Fifth, I am one of the few people that think the Tiberon is terrible. It looks fantastic visually but the stats on it are my real problem. First off you have to build it out of a current Latron AND a Forma. Afterwards you only get one polarity. On top of that it has basically no critical chance and essentially no status chance. Combining that with what you have to build it out of and you can see my big issue with this weapon. The weapon should have better stats than what you build it out of, period, and throwing a forma into the mix should make it even better. Now I am not saying this should be on the same tier as a prime weapon, but it does need to be better that the weapon you build it out of. Now I know some will say that it is now a burst rifle and that makes up for it's faults, but it doesn't. All I would like changed with the weapon is for it to have better crit and status chances so it could be a contender not only against the latron line, but with other burst weapons in the game as well.     Here why don't we give this an example. The new armor set costs 200 plat. You can buy Loki, Excalibur, and Volt for 75 plat. Then we can factor in with that price tag that there is an included warframe slot at 20 plat and a reactor at 20 plat as well. Therefore 40 of that 75 is spent on items needed to not only have the particular frame, but the item to use it more effectively. The point being that cosmetics are absurdly priced over something you are needed to have to play the game, meaning you have to use a frame and not necessarily the ones I have listed, is just plain ridiculous. Prices need to be tweaked to not only keep veteran players alive, but to keep new players interested in the game as well.
